Итак, мы «обновились» до ExtJS 4.0.2a.
Я пытаюсь создать простое окно с набором полей, которое имеет три входа и скрывается при закрытии (как я сделал с 4.0.1).
addModWindow = Ext.create('Ext.Window',{
title: 'Title',
frame: true,
width: 500,
height: 200,
closable: true,
closeAction: 'hide',
layout: {
type: 'fit',
align: 'center'
},
defaults: {
bodyPadding: 4
},
resizable: false,
items: [{
xtype: 'fieldset',
labelWidth: 75,
title: 'Rule Values',
collapsible: false,
defaults: {
anchor: '100%'
},
width: 490,
items: [typeComboBox,ruleTextBox,notesTextArea]
}]
});
typeComboBox,ruleTextBox, notesTextArea определены чуть выше этого блока и, похоже, не имеют никаких проблем (так как я удалил элементы и все еще имею эту проблему).
Когда отображается окно, тело окна иЗакрыть окно визуализации правильно, но заголовок окна теперь прозрачный и имеет минимальный стиль (семейство шрифтов).Я прикрепил крышки экрана от FF4, IE8 и Chrome.
Кто-нибудь еще видел эту проблему и нашел, как избавиться от прозрачности?В IE8, когда вы перемещаете окно, вы видите правильную стилизацию заголовка окна, что заставляет меня думать, что классы CSS не применяются правильно.
В FF4:
В IE8:
IE8 Move:
В Chrome: